Liquid Screed Benefits. Increased productivity – 2000m2/day can be easily achieved. (For an average 500-1000 m2/day) Can be walked on in 24-48 hours and Can be force dried as early as 7 days after appliion. Extremely low shrinkage – does not curl and minimises the risk of cracking. Dries at a rate of 1mm per day up to a screed depth of 40mm.

Isocrete Composite K-Screed is a topping of Standard Isocrete K-Screed laid over a base of lightweight aggregate used for weight saving e.g. on roofs. Additional data sheets are available for Isocrete K-Screed for weight saving, for impact sound installation, for thermal insulation and for underfloor heating.

2011-2-1 · In this study, an expanded perlite obtained from Bergama-Izmir, loed in the west region of Turkey, was used. The perlite used consisted mainly of 73% SiO 2 and 16% Al 2 O 3.Unit weight and water absorption of the perlite were 54 kg/m 3 and 310%, respectively.
